One of the best reasons to use Yack is that you’re able to have multiple accounts for one community. When you log in, all of your data is stored locally on your device - nothing is ever stored on Yack’s servers. You can browse freely, but you’ll need to log in to your account if you want to post or reply to people. Until you log in to your account, you’ll just be an “Anonymous User” with a list of popular channels or recommendations. ![]() Simply click on the icon of the one you want to view. Each one is represented by their logo and color, so it’s easy to tell them apart with a single glance. Then choose the network you want to add, and it gets added in the communities column. You have your communities all the way in the most left column, then all of your subscribed forums and topics in the second column, list of posts in the third column, and the actual discussion in the fourth and last column.Īdding a community is easy, as all you need to do is click the big “+” button in the first column. The overall design for Yack reminds me of Slack, to be honest. The unified experience for your communities is similar to the unified inbox of most email apps these days. The mission behind Yack is to provide the most simple and streamlined user experience across different social networks and communities on the desktop. With Yack, you’re able to log in and browse Reddit, YouTube, Hacker News, and Indie Hackers, all within a single app window. Yack! bills itself as a unified community browser that consolidates your favorite networks, communities, accounts, and content into a single space.
